Michael Palmisano Obituary
Passed away peacefully, surrounded by his loving family, on December 4, 2025 at the age of 72. Beloved husband and best friend of Linda (nee Garton). Devoted dad of Nicole (Michael) Wolfe, Kelli (Henry) Sims-Dorsey and Michael Palmisano II. Dear stepfather of Sarah and Kimmee (Nicholas). Adored Grandpa and Papa of Shonterria, Samantha (Zeke), Sean, Amyah, Madison, Henrianna, Michael, Mia, Carolina, Addilyn, Griffin, Boden and Talan. Loving brother of Mary Ellen (Jack) Kennedy, Annette (Jim) Stannard, Chris (Ron) Reams and Terri (Eric) Stanley. Mike will be greatly missed by other family and many friends.
Mike loved rooting on the Brewers, Bucks and Packers. He loved a good movie, a funny comedian or anything on the "oldies station", often driving along to Bob Seager, Dion and the Belmonts or Jim Croce. But above all else, he really loved to gamble. Slot machines, video poker and bingo at Potawatomi were a few of his favorites. Mike was an avid card player and loved playing games of all kinds. He loved spending time with his children and his grandchildren. He proudly cheered them on through all their endeavors and truly treasured all their accomplishments.
Mike will always be remembered for his quick wit, sense of humor and his generous heart. He was always there when you needed something, be it a smile, a story, a lesson or his opinion, it was always delivered with love. He was a husband, father, grandfather, brother, uncle, cousin and friend to many. His memory will live on in the hearts of all who loved him.
A visitation will be held on Sunday December 21, 2025 at the Becker Ritter Funeral Home from 12 PM until 2:45 PM. Mike's Celebration of Life will be held at 3 PM. To honor Mike's memory please perform a kind act, put a smile on someone's face or put some money in a slot machine and see if you get lucky.
